Output 27395544310bd01bd1a650be3f70da643bae0c659a88ff708fc4d08ad7f31a2e: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ebe108b9d77754c0a610e1de53515c92516bc2 OP_EQUAL
address
3J6MT3XYFnahtzMy7AmcooaCFAhrkJ1nEx
transaction
27395544310bd01bd1a650be3f70da643bae0c659a88ff708fc4d08ad7f31a2e
spent
true